Triathlon Apparel Market Size

According to Deep Market Insights, the global triathlon apparel market size was valued at USD 2,450 million in 2025 and is projected to grow from USD 2,641.10 million in 2026 to reach USD 3,844.84 million by 2031, expanding at a CAGR of 7.8% during the forecast period (2026–2031). The triathlon apparel market growth is primarily driven by increasing participation in endurance sports, rising health and fitness awareness, and continuous innovation in high-performance sportswear materials. The demand for multifunctional apparel designed for swimming, cycling, and running has expanded beyond professional athletes to include amateur participants and fitness enthusiasts. Additionally, the integration of advanced fabrics such as moisture-wicking, UV-protective, and compression textiles is enhancing product performance and consumer appeal globally.

Product Type Insights

Triathlon suits remain the dominant product category, contributing approximately 38% of global revenue in 2025, primarily due to their integrated, multi-functional design that seamlessly supports swimming, cycling, and running. The leading driver for this segment is the growing preference for performance optimization and transition efficiency, as athletes seek apparel that minimizes time loss between disciplines while maximizing aerodynamics and comfort. Continuous innovation in compression fabrics, hydrophobic coatings, and ergonomic paneling further strengthens the adoption of trisuits among both professional and amateur athletes.

Swimwear, including wetsuits and swimsuits, holds a significant share driven by performance enhancement in open-water swimming and regulatory compliance in competitive events. The demand is particularly strong in colder regions where wetsuits are essential. Cycling and running apparel segments are experiencing steady growth, supported by their cross-functional usage in standalone cycling and running activities, expanding their applicability beyond triathlon events. Accessories such as compression socks, visors, and race belts, while contributing a smaller share, are gaining traction due to the increasing focus on marginal performance gains and athlete convenience, particularly among competitive participants.

Regional Insights

North America

North America holds the largest market share at approximately 34% in 2025, with the United States accounting for the majority of demand. The primary growth driver in this region is the high participation rate in triathlon events combined with strong consumer purchasing power, enabling widespread adoption of premium and technologically advanced apparel. The presence of established triathlon organizations, frequent competitive events, and strong brand penetration further supports market growth. Canada also contributes to regional expansion, driven by increasing health awareness and government-supported sports initiatives.

Europe

Europe accounts for around 29% of the global market, led by countries such as the UK, Germany, and France. The key driver for regional growth is the strong cultural inclination toward endurance sports and sustainability-focused consumption. European consumers show a high preference for eco-friendly and performance-oriented apparel, encouraging brands to innovate in sustainable materials. Additionally, stringent environmental regulations and government support for green manufacturing are accelerating the adoption of sustainable triathlon apparel across the region.

Asia-Pacific

Asia-Pacific is the fastest-growing region, with a CAGR exceeding 9%. China, Japan, and Australia are major contributors, while India is emerging as a high-growth market. The primary driver in this region is the rapid urbanization and rising disposable incomes, which are increasing consumer spending on fitness and sports apparel. Additionally, the growing popularity of endurance sports, the expanding middle-class population, and increasing digital penetration are driving demand. Government initiatives promoting sports participation and the expansion of local triathlon events further support regional growth.

Latin America

Latin America accounts for approximately 8% of the market, with Brazil and Mexico leading demand. The key growth driver is the rising interest in international triathlon events and increasing sports participation among younger demographics. Improvements in sports infrastructure and the growing influence of global fitness trends are also contributing to market expansion. Additionally, the emergence of local sporting communities and sponsorship-driven events is supporting the adoption of specialized apparel in the region.

Middle East & Africa

The Middle East & Africa region holds a smaller share of around 5% but is witnessing steady growth. The primary driver is the increasing government investment in sports infrastructure and promotion of fitness initiatives, particularly in countries such as the UAE and South Africa. High disposable incomes in the Middle East are supporting the adoption of premium sportswear, while Africa is benefiting from the growing popularity of endurance events and international competitions. Additionally, the development of sports tourism and global event hosting is further boosting regional demand for triathlon apparel.
